Transaction e8a089f26eae128ee493eabd0657ddc641524424d0221fcfdfecfcd89aff9f89
2 Input
2 Outputs
- e8a089f26eae128ee493eabd0657ddc641524424d0221fcfdfecfcd89aff9f89:0
- e8a089f26eae128ee493eabd0657ddc641524424d0221fcfdfecfcd89aff9f89:1
value 1001293
address 1MkMPDua9AFcqWKcXr9XTu4Ny6UYkmUEQr
value 178195546
address 1Dx68Haj3THnCsDpnqGPkFdmfqneDq9yBW